  Skin cancer is the most common of all cancers. Every 67 minutes someone dies from melanoma. The American Cancer Society estimates that over 62,000 new melanomas will be diagnosed in the United States each year and more than one million cases of non-melanoma skin cancer are also found. Protecting our skin from sun can prevent up to 80% of these skin cancers, and nearly 80% of all sun damage is done to our skin by the time we are 18 years old. These little-known facts stimulated dermatologists at The Skin Institute at the Rapid City Medical Center and local parents to organize and raise funds to provide shade on playgrounds.
